PinPoint #791: Connecting the Dots to the Ultimate Camping List

PinPoint #791 is a puzzle that asks: What things are brought on a camping trip? The clues seem random at first, but they form a perfect narrative of outdoor preparation. Let’s connect them step by step.

Starting Point: The Lantern

The first hint, Lantern, immediately sparks thoughts of light and nighttime comfort. Could the answer be lighting equipment? Or perhaps things you need after dark? The possibilities are broad: flashlights, headlamps, or even candles. But a lantern specifically suggests a central, stationary source of light for a campsite, not just personal gear.

Hints 2 & 3: Narrowing the Field

Enter Sleeping Bag and Portable Stove. These two clues drastically shift the focus. Sleeping Bag points to rest and shelter, while Portable Stove points to cooking and food.

Now, the answer can’t just be about light (lantern) or just about rest (sleeping bag). It must be a comprehensive category that includes light, rest, and cooking. This eliminates narrow categories like bedding or kitchen tools. The field is now narrowed to broader concepts like outdoor equipment or camping gear.

Hints 4 & 5: The Final Confirmation

The final hints, Water Filter and Tent, seal the deal. Water Filter adds the critical element of hydration and safety, while Tent reinforces the shelter aspect.

When you combine all five clues:

  • Lantern (Light)
  • Sleeping Bag (Rest)
  • Portable Stove (Cooking)
  • Water Filter (Hydration)
  • Tent (Shelter)

They form the classic essential checklist for a camping trip. The wordplay here is direct: each item is a staple brought along when you go camping. The puzzle isn’t about a hidden metaphor; it’s about recognizing the common theme that ties these seemingly unrelated items together.

How We Got the Final Answer

The path to the answer was straightforward but required noticing the pattern:

  1. Identify the individual items: Each hint is a specific piece of camping gear.
  2. Find the common thread: All items are brought when you go camping. They aren’t just used at a campsite; they are transported to get there.
  3. Eliminate distractors: Narrow categories like bedding or cooking supplies don’t fit all five clues. Only a comprehensive list like things brought on a camping trip does.

The final answer is Things brought on a camping trip. It’s the perfect Aha! moment where the puzzle’s simplicity reveals its elegance: the clues aren’t hiding a secret; they’re just listing the essentials of the trip itself.
